This past weekend Stars Assistant Coach Lowell Egan was inducted into the McDermitt, Nevada High School Hall of Fame! Egan led the Bulldogs to a Nevada 1A State Championship Title in 2001-2002.
The school has also named an award after Lowell. The Lowell Egan Award will go to the Top Senior Male Athlete at McDermitt High School.
Congratulations Coach! McDermitt, Nevada is on the Oregon-Nevada border about 80 miles north on Winnemucca.

I saw this on the interwebs regarding the TWolves and a veteran free agent minicamp:
Sources said the Timberwolves have invited, among others, guards Semaj Christon and Milton Doyle, forwards Jamel Artis and Jarrod Uthoff, and center Amida Brimah. Other participants, as reported by Darren Wolfson, are Keenan Evans, Briante Weber, Mychal Mulder, Rayvonte Rice, Wade Baldwin, Xavier Munford, and Matt Costello.
